Obama Dogged By 'Bitter' Remarks
Barack Obama continues to be criticized after telling a San Francisco crowd that people in economically depressed towns were bitter about government and turned to religion and guns. What do you think?
Taylor Barnes,
Sales Representative
"He forgot to mention the Sizzler. Poor people love that place."
Pete Crespin,
Blackjack Dealer
"Joke's on them. The government controls those things, too."
Artie Jefferson,
Tour Guide
"Hillary knew a young, inexperienced Obama would slip up sooner or later and be honest with people."
